Rotation, a guess

 

Guards

1. Coleman/Lawrence (Lloyd/Jacobsen)

2. Keisei (Coleman/Brice/Lawrence/Wilcher/Lloyd/Hoiberg)

3. Brice/Wilcher (Rice/Lloyd)

 

F/C

4. Gary/Allick (Wilcher/Brice/Rice)

5. Mast  (Allick/Keita/Diop)

 

Listing guys by positions I think they play by default

BOLD indicates guys I think are in the rotation to start the season

Guys in (parentheses) are the backups

 

  • I have Keita listed as in the rotation and a backup because I think he's in the rotation when healthy and I'm not sure when he'll be healthy enough to be in the rotation
  • We have 3 post players for roughly two spots with Keita and Diop being question marks.  That tells me we don't have the luxury of rolling out Mast, Allick and Gary at the same time
  • The limiting factors of our guards I see in the rotation are that only 2 guys can likely play PG and Keisei can only be a SG. I think another limiting factor is that you don't want to play Keisei and Wilcher together much for defensive purposes. 
  • With the size and rebounding ability of some of our big guards I expect to see some 4 guard lineups
